Output 820545baab5baaa7991a358a85077cc78da871c0df9498b2eaa1bcd241fb8a93:59

value
31791
script pubkey
OP_0 OP_PUSHBYTES_20 a85bedc85a08efc8c11ae27b95e7d41361f4a6ee
address
bc1q4pd7mjz6prhu3sg6ufaete75zdslffhwqj65v3
transaction
820545baab5baaa7991a358a85077cc78da871c0df9498b2eaa1bcd241fb8a93
confirmations
126212
spent
true